Jürgen Schröder (Germanist)
Jürgen Schröder (born May 3, 1935 in Woldenberg ) is Full Professor Emeritus for Modern German Literature at the Eberhard Karls University of Tübingen .
Life
After a doctorate (1961) and habilitation (1969) at the Albert-Ludwigs-Universität Freiburg , Jürgen Schröder was appointed to the chair of Modern German Literature at the Eberhard Karls Universität Tübingen in 1974 as successor to Klaus Ziegler . He held this position until his retirement in 2001. Schröder has held visiting professorships at Washington University in St. Louis / USA, the University of Massachusetts in Amherst / USA, the University of Western Australia in Perth / Australia and the University of Washington in Seattle / USA. Schröder is best known for his studies on Gottfried Benn , whose most important correspondence he edited, on Heinrich von Kleist , Georg Büchner , Gotthold Ephraim Lessing , Robert Musil , Ödön von Horváth and Max Frisch , on German historical drama, and German-language drama after 1945 and on the subject of Germany poems.
